Job Position: Regional Credit Manager
Locations: North Central, North East, North West, South East, South South – Nigeria
About the Role
- The Regional Credit Manager is saddled with the duty of managing a credit portfolio in an assigned geographic region. The Regional Credit Manager is expected to maintain a profitable loan portfolio and manage the field credit network in that region.
- The Regional Credit Manager is a data-driven and strategic leader who leverages data to effectively guide his team towards meeting business and financial objectives.
- You would also be directly involved in managing key accounts in the region to ensure they perform and to eliminate churn.
- The Regional Credit Manager must be an expert in credit risk, credit monitoring and credit analysis and should be able to distil this information into the field credit network under his/her management.
Job Responsibilities
- Oversee and maintain a profitable loan portfolio within the assigned region.
- Drive achievement of loan disbursement targets for the region.
- Monitor portfolio performance and ensure loan defaults remain within acceptable thresholds.
- Supervise and support the regional field network to deliver on growth, profitability, and efficiency objectives.
- Ensure timely execution of all key credit field operations in compliance with internal policies and established SLAs.
- Provide management with strategic insights on regional credit performance, risks, and emerging opportunities.
- Build and maintain strong relationships with the sales network to support lending business expansion.
- Manage key accounts and foster long-term partnerships with major customers.
- Actively track the regional credit portfolio and implement proactive measures to mitigate default risks.
- Coach, train, and mentor the regional credit team to strengthen capacity and performance.
- Identify, recruit, develop, and retain top-performing talent within the regional credit network.
- Undertake other credit-related assignments as delegated by supervisors.
Qualifications and Skills
- Candidates should possess a Bachelor’s Degree in Finance, Accounting, Economics, Business Administration, or a related field (Master’s degree or MBA is an added advantage).
- Must have 7–10 years’ experience in credit risk management, lending operations, or related roles, with at least 3–5 years in a supervisory or regional leadership capacity.
- Strong knowledge of credit analysis, loan underwriting, portfolio management, and collections strategies.
- Proven ability to manage large loan portfolios while maintaining profitability and minimising default rates.
- Strong understanding of credit risk frameworks, regulatory requirements (CBN guidelines, IFRS 9, etc.), and industry best practices.
- Demonstrated track record in driving loan growth in retail, SME, or agent-based lending models.
- Strong data analysis and reporting skills; proficiency in Excel, credit MIS tools, and other financial systems.
- Excellent leadership and people management skills, with experience in building, mentoring, and retaining high-performing teams.
- Strong stakeholder management abilities, including collaboration with sales, operations, and risk teams.
- Analytical thinker with problem-solving skills and the ability to make sound credit decisions under pressure.
- Strong communication and presentation skills, with the ability to provide actionable insights to senior management.
- High ethical standards, integrity, and sound judgment in credit decision-making.
